Role Overview

The Machining & Technology Manager is responsible for overseeing all aspects of machine shop operations, including production planning, personnel leadership, quality control, process development, and technology management. This role ensures that production schedules, quality standards, and delivery commitments are consistently met while supporting cost control and profitability objectives.

This position requires a hands-on leader with strong machining expertise, technical problem-solving skills, and a continuous improvement mindset within a manufacturing environment.

Core Responsibilities

  • Plan, coordinate, and oversee daily machine shop operations to meet production schedules, quality requirements, and delivery commitments
  • Develop, implement, and maintain standard operating procedures (SOPs) across machining operations
  • Monitor and manage labor utilization, tooling costs, scrap rates, overtime, and equipment maintenance expenses
  • Support quoting activities, cost-reduction initiatives, and overall shop profitability goals
  • Lead, train, mentor, and evaluate machinists, programmers, and support staff
  • Enforce shop policies, performance standards, and safety procedures
  • Develop individualized training and skills-development plans for operators
  • Ensure all machined parts meet engineering drawings, specifications, and quality standards
  • Enforce inspection procedures and corrective actions for nonconforming parts
  • Enforce safety programs including machine guarding, lockout/tagout, and OSHA compliance
